Biography
Professor David R Haynes is Deputy Head of the School of Medicine, University of Adelaide. He has published well over 100 publications in respected peer reviewed journals. Over the past two decades he has developed a respected international reputation in the fields of bone pathologies, biomaterials and inflammation. Over the past decade he has been President and Secretary of the Australian and New Zealand Society of Orthopaedic Research (www.ANZORS.org.au). In these roles he has help organise more than 5 national and 3 international meetings. Professor Haynes has been chief investigator on more than 17 successful major national and international grants (NH&MRC, European Union Framework 7 and ARC) grants since the early 1990’s as well as several commercially funded studies on pharmacological regulation of inflammatory cytokines, pathogenic bone loss and implant loosening. He also makes a significant contribution to the training of medical students (MBBS), Health Science students and Nursing students in the Faculty of Health and Medical Sciences.
